Adecco is seeking a dedicated Electrician in Chesterfield for a rewarding opportunity in the housing sector. This role involves performing electrical repairs, conducting compliance tests, and ensuring high-quality service to customers in domestic properties.

The ideal candidate will have:

  • a minimum of 2 years of experience
  • relevant qualifications including 18th Edition IEE
  • strong communication skills

Along with a competitive salary, Adecco offers a supportive environment to foster professional development.
